Merchants will pay 7-9% for a full payment service which delivers sales vs. 2% interchange
Merchants complain about paying 2% interchange fees, yet, according to a new report, they are willing to pay 7-9% for an enhanced pament transaction that helps them sell better.

Merchants complain about paying 2% for payment processing, most of which is interchange, yet, according to a new report by Deloitte, they are willing to pay 7-9% to companies like Google that envelop the e-commerce payment transaction within the online shopping context and actually deliver sales.
